The Thirty-Nine Articles of Religion were established in 1563, and are the historic defining statements of Anglican doctrine. The articles, finalized in 1571, had a lasting effect on religion in the United Kingdom and elsewhere through their incorporation into and propagation through the Book of Common Prayer.
